## Support

Tidewrack sweeps orphaned volumes and stale load balancers nightly in the Quillhaven environment. It is deliberately conservative: anything tagged `keep` is skipped. If it deletes something it shouldn't, check the dry-run log first — nine times out of ten the tag was missing. Patches welcome; keep the sweep idempotent.

For anything the logs can't explain, reach the current maintainer here.

escalation mailbox, bafog-fafog: ulador@paliqlabs.internal

Handover Note — Incoming Director

Damon — pilot churn in the Orvett programme hit 11% last month, mostly mid-tier accounts citing onboarding friction. Retention calls are booked through week three; Selma owns the tracker. Exit surveys land Friday. Don't renegotiate the Bracken contract until churn stabilises. Background on where this fits our plans sits in the confidential note below.

board note of hahag-yajop: Eliysox Logistics plans to raise the Ralion list price by 56 percent in April.

Runbook: Dedupe service (Quellfire)

If duplicate pages fire, check the fingerprint window first — default is 90s. Restart only the collator pod, never the full set. Flush the fingerprint cache after any config change or dupes resurface. Escalate to the Halden rota if suppression exceeds 5%. Full escalation matrix and current suppression thresholds live on the internal page below.

dashboard of kafop-yagep = https://jira.zemvarsys.internal/pages/pages/pages/display/cc87

## Changelog — Sproutly Scheduler v2.3

- Watering windows now respect per-plant soil-moisture thresholds instead of fixed intervals.
- Fixed a bug where overlapping schedules double-triggered the pump relay.
- Added a dry-run mode for new greenhouse zones.
- Migration note: legacy interval configs are auto-converted on first boot.

New team members: for context on these changes and review history, the maintainer of record is listed below.

account owner for bawip-tahag: Raleth Quenok